Black Olive & Spinach Pesto

This is a lovely twist on a classic pesto – somewhere between a pesto and a tapenade, but without the anchovies. It has a wonderful depth of flavour and, dare I say it, I think I may even prefer it to our more familiar basil pesto. It’s wonderfully versatile too. Toss it through pasta, spread it generously into a crusty sourdough sandwich, serve it alongside grilled meats or roasted vegetables, or add a bowlful to an antipasti board. It’s also really good swirled through a chilled tomato gazpacho, where that salty, savoury olive flavour really comes into its own.

Ingredients

  • 30 g garlic approx. 2 cloves
  • 30 g 3 tbsp freshly grated Parmesan cheese
  • 50 g 3 tbsp whole almonds
  • 100 g pitted black olives such as Kalamata
  • 60 g young spinach leaves
  • 20 g parsley leaves only
  • ¼ tsp chilli flakes
  • Seasoning
  • 300 ml good quality extra virgin olive oil
  • 30 ml Udo’s Choice oil

Method

  • Place all ingredients except the olive oil into a food processor and blitz for a few seconds. Then continue to whiz while slowly adding the olive oil and Udo’s Choice oil until blended.
  • Pour into a sterilised Kilner jar and cover with a layer of olive oil. Close the lid and store in the fridge for 2 weeks.

Maggie's Tips

  • A Nut-free option: Omit, no need to replace with anything.
  • Dairy-free /Vegan option: Omit parmesan. You can replace with 1 small avocado or leave it out completely.
  • Replace almonds with hazelnuts, walnuts or cashew nuts.
